Real-World Testing: Putting Icom Belt Clip f/M34, M36 & M92D to the Test

First Use Experience

I first put the Icom Belt Clip f/M34, M36 & M92D to the test while working on a construction site, where my radio is constantly in and out of my pocket or clipped to my belt. The environment presented dust, occasional light moisture from dew, and frequent jarring movements as I navigated the site. Attaching the clip to the radio was an intuitive process, requiring no special tools or instructions, and it snapped into place with a reassuring click.

The clip offered immediate stability, keeping the radio securely fastened to my belt throughout the workday. There were no significant issues or surprises, though I did notice that the clip’s grip on thicker work belts could be a bit tighter. It felt natural to have the radio readily accessible without it being an encumbrance.

Extended Use & Reliability

After several weeks of consistent use across various demanding scenarios, the belt clip has held up remarkably well. It’s been subjected to repeated clipping and unclipping, and remains firmly attached to both my radio and my belt. There are no visible signs of stress, cracks, or stiffness in the plastic, and the spring mechanism for the clip action still feels as strong as day one.

Maintenance has been minimal; a quick wipe with a damp cloth is usually sufficient to remove any accumulated dust or grime. Compared to some generic clips I’ve used in the past, which often became loose or broke after a short period, this Icom accessory has proven its durability. It certainly performs better than those cheaper, ill-fitting alternatives.

Performance & Functionality

The primary job of this belt clip is to keep your radio securely attached to your person, and in this regard, it performs exceptionally well. The snap-on attachment to the radio is firm, and the spring-loaded clip on the other end provides a strong grip on belts. I experienced no instances of the radio accidentally detaching, even during vigorous physical activity or when brushing against objects.

Its main strength lies in its purpose-built design; it perfectly mates with the contours of the compatible Icom radios. A slight weakness, if one could call it that, is its limited compatibility – it will not fit other radio brands or even other Icom models not listed. It meets expectations by providing a reliable carrying solution, and given its price point, it exceeds expectations for basic functionality.

Design & Ergonomics

The build quality of the clip feels robust, made from what appears to be durable, high-impact plastic. It’s designed to withstand the rigors of daily use in various environments. The clip itself is spring-loaded, offering a satisfying tension that grips securely without being overly difficult to open.

Ergonomically, it’s a simple, no-fuss design. The clip is shaped to be unobtrusive and doesn’t snag on other gear easily. The textured surface of the clip’s belt-gripping part helps maintain its position, preventing slippage.
